## ✨ Features

- 🎯 **Keyword Search**: Search YouTube videos, channels, playlists by keywords
- 📹 **Video Details**: Get comprehensive video information including metadata
- 📋 **Playlist Support**: Extract playlist contents and metadata
- 📺 **Channel Information**: Retrieve channel details and content
- 🩳 **YouTube Shorts**: Access YouTube Shorts content
- 📄 **Pagination**: Handle large result sets with next page functionality
- 🚀 **Fast & Reliable**: Built with httpx for high performance
- 🔧 **Type Safe**: Full Pydantic model support with type hints
- 🎛️ **Flexible Options**: Filter by content type (video, channel, playlist, movie)

## 🚀 Quick Start

### Basic Search

```python
from pytubesearch import PyTubeSearch

# Initialize the client
client = PyTubeSearch()

# Search for videos
results = client.search("python programming")

# Display results
for item in results.items:
    print(f"Title: {item.title}")
    print(f"Channel: {item.channel_title}")
    print(f"Video ID: {item.id}")
    print("-" * 50)

# Close the client
client.close()
```

### Using Context Manager

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    results = client.search("machine learning", limit=10)
    
    for video in results.items:
        if video.type == "video":
            print(f"📹 {video.title} by {video.channel_title}")
```

### Advanced Search with Filters

```python
from pytubesearch import PyTubeSearch, SearchOptions

with PyTubeSearch() as client:
    # Search only for videos
    video_options = [SearchOptions(type="video")]
    results = client.search("python tutorial", options=video_options, limit=5)
    
    # Search only for channels
    channel_options = [SearchOptions(type="channel")]
    channels = client.search("tech channels", options=channel_options, limit=3)
    
    # Search with playlists included
    playlist_results = client.search("programming courses", with_playlist=True)
```

### Get Video Details

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    # Get detailed video information
    video_details = client.get_video_details("dQw4w9WgXcQ")
    
    print(f"Title: {video_details.title}")
    print(f"Channel: {video_details.channel}")
    print(f"Description: {video_details.description}")
    print(f"Keywords: {video_details.keywords}")
    print(f"Is Live: {video_details.is_live}")
    
    # Get suggested videos
    for suggestion in video_details.suggestion:
        print(f"Suggested: {suggestion.title}")
```

### Pagination

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    # Get first page
    results = client.search("data science")
    
    # Process first page
    for item in results.items:
        print(f"Page 1: {item.title}")
    
    # Get next page
    if results.next_page.next_page_token:
        next_results = client.next_page(results.next_page)
        
        for item in next_results.items:
            print(f"Page 2: {item.title}")
```

### Playlist Operations

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    # Get playlist contents
    playlist = client.get_playlist_data("PLrAXtmRdnEQy9j4XPpPNJkr0bO8E4BcJj")
    
    print(f"Playlist has {len(playlist.items)} videos")
    
    for video in playlist.items:
        print(f"🎥 {video.title}")
        print(f"   Channel: {video.channel_title}")
```

### Channel Information

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    # Get channel information
    channel_data = client.get_channel_by_id("UC8butISFwT-Wl7EV0hUK0BQ")
    
    for tab in channel_data:
        print(f"Tab: {tab.title}")
```

### YouTube Shorts

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    # Get YouTube Shorts
    shorts = client.get_short_videos()
    
    for short in shorts:
        print(f"🩳 {short.title}")
        print(f"   ID: {short.id}")
```

### Homepage Suggestions

```python
from pytubesearch import PyTubeSearch

with PyTubeSearch() as client:
    # Get homepage suggestions
    suggestions = client.get_suggestions(limit=10)
    
    for video in suggestions:
        print(f"💡 {video.title}")
        print(f"   Channel: {video.channel_title}")
```

## 📚 API Reference

### PyTubeSearch Class

#### Methods

- `search(keyword, with_playlist=False, limit=0, options=None)`: Search YouTube content
- `next_page(next_page_data, with_playlist=False, limit=0)`: Get next page of results
- `get_video_details(video_id)`: Get detailed video information
- `get_playlist_data(playlist_id, limit=0)`: Get playlist contents
- `get_channel_by_id(channel_id)`: Get channel information
- `get_suggestions(limit=0)`: Get homepage suggestions
- `get_short_videos()`: Get YouTube Shorts

### Models

- `SearchResult`: Contains search results and pagination data
- `SearchItem`: Individual search result item
- `VideoDetails`: Detailed video information
- `PlaylistResult`: Playlist contents and metadata
- `ChannelResult`: Channel information
- `ShortVideo`: YouTube Shorts data
- `SearchOptions`: Search filtering options

### Testing

The project uses pytest for testing with multiple test categories:

1. **Unit Tests**: Fast tests that don't require network access
   ```bash
   pytest tests/ -m "not integration"
   ```

2. **Integration Tests**: Tests that interact with real YouTube data
   ```bash
   pytest tests/ -m "integration"
   ```

3. **All Tests with Coverage**:
   ```bash
   pytest tests/ --cov=pytubesearch --cov-report=html
   ```

## 🔧 Configuration

### Timeout Settings

```python
from pytubesearch import PyTubeSearch

# Set custom timeout (default: 30 seconds)
client = PyTubeSearch(timeout=60.0)
```

### Error Handling

```python
from pytubesearch import PyTubeSearch, PyTubeSearchError

try:
    with PyTubeSearch() as client:
        results = client.search("programming")
except PyTubeSearchError as e:
    print(f"Search failed: {e}")
```
